Transaction 2dfbf159e76a2189f40ae55c6f5dcbc32a32111eb5d42a94a2033fac26bd64b0
1 Input
1 Output
-
2dfbf159e76a2189f40ae55c6f5dcbc32a32111eb5d42a94a2033fac26bd64b0:0
- value
- 1068
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f9ab40a99392f3011d11f96dfe54e669539d409 OP_EQUAL
- address
- 3AQXSju7nfUP5EFpFxQ5g98NVPDusmvpRF